www.Fark.com is a moderated headline news site, updated every hour,
that links to news and stories of interest as they
happen from all
parts of the globe. Founded in 1997 by a mysterious, brooding figure
known only as Drew, Fark aims to present the news when, where and how
it happens, regardless of how witless or inane it may be, because no
matter what it is, it is surely important to someone, somewhere.
Obviously, Drew--whoever he is--is surely doing something right,
because the site received more than 400 million page views in 2004
alone.
Its readership is actively to discuss and comment on news stories
in the site forums, to chime in an opinion or inject an opposing or
supporting point of view at any time. Anyone with internet access, an
opinion of their own, a desire to be heard, and a thick skin is welcome
to join in--but if you are easily offended, if you overly sensitive and
find your feelings are easily hurt by the opinions of others, then
leave it at the door. Its members represent a cross-section of internet
users from around the world and from all walks of life, and as a
result, discussion threads tend to be irreverent in the extreme and
occasionally can become rather heated. However, even the most firey
argument can frequently bring forth unexpected insight into current
events, nothing is ever taken personally, and the
moderators tend not
to allow flame wars to devolve to the level of
personal attack.
Although anyone is free to read the forums, posting to them
requires site membership, but the basic subscription is entirely free.
Members may post to the forums, take part in photoshop contests, make
personal contacts with other members, and submit links to news articles
for approval to the moderators. And for 5.00 USD per month, users can
subscribe to Total Fark, gaining access to the full list of news
stories which are submitted, among other perks. While some site content
may be objectionable by local standards, no one may post comments or
photos to the forums with obvious graphic language, gratuitous full or
partial nudity, graphic content, or anything involving minors in an
adult situation, and those who try to do so will be banned. The same
goes for messages encouraging patently illegal activities, obvious hate
speech, public or private information, empty comments or comments
reposting something that was deleted for any of the reasons above. Fark
prides itself on being generally work-safe. As long as these guidelines
are followed, the sky's the limit.
